Managing conduct

A 90-minute webinar

This webinar focuses on how to manage disciplinary issues effectively.

The emphasis is on the use of a structured approach, with problems identified early and managed positively and proactively. The session builds knowledge and confidence in handling these issues objectively, fairly and appropriately in line with internal policies / procedures, best practice and legal requirements.

This webinar can be complemented by separate sessions on ‘Workplace investigations’, ‘Managing capability’ and ‘Managing grievances’.

Learning objectives

  • Understand the benefits of managing conduct proactively
  • Be able to manage conduct informally where appropriate
  • Understand how to take formal disciplinary action in line with policies and procedures
  • Be clear on the manager’s role and responsibility at each stage
  • Appreciate the employment law issues involved

Audience

Anyone in an organisation of any sort with responsibility for managing conduct – or with responsibility for advising managers.

  • HR professionals
  • Line managers
